Convert VIFF to TXT BRAILE6DOTS on macOS

Follow steps below if you have installed Vertopal CLI on your macOS system.

  1. Open macOS Terminal.
  2. Either cd to VIFF file location or include path to your input file.
  3. Paste and execute the command below, substituting in your VIFF_INPUT_FILE name or path. $ vertopal convert VIFF_INPUT_FILE --to txt-braile6dots
